Course Details

Building Energy Efficiency: Understanding energy codes, standards, and rating systems; analyzing building energy use; implementing energy-efficient solutions.
Indoor Environmental Quality: Assessing and improving indoor air quality, thermal comfort, and lighting quality; incorporating sustainable materials and reducing waste.
Building Envelope: Designing and optimizing building enclosures for energy efficiency, durability, and comfort; selecting appropriate materials and assemblies.
HVAC Systems: Selecting and sizing HVAC systems; improving system performance and efficiency; integrating renewable energy sources.
Building Controls and Automation: Implementing building automation systems; optimizing control strategies; monitoring and analyzing building performance data.
Renewable Energy Technologies: Understanding renewable energy options for buildings; designing and integrating solar, wind, and geothermal systems.
Water Conservation: Reducing water consumption in buildings; implementing water-efficient fixtures and appliances; managing stormwater and greywater.
Sustainable Design and LEED Certification: Applying sustainable design principles; understanding LEED rating system and certification process.
Building Performance Modeling: Using energy modeling tools to analyze and predict building performance; evaluating design alternatives and retrofit options.
Whole Building Commissioning: Implementing commissioning process for new and existing buildings; ensuring building systems function as intended.

Career Path

The professional certificate in Building Performance Trends offers a comprehensive understanding of various roles in the UK's building performance sector. Discover the industry-relevant positions and their respective demands through a 3D pie chart. The chart showcases the following roles and their respective market percentages: 1. Building Physics Engineer: This position focuses on analyzing and optimizing building physics, such as heat, air, and moisture transfer. With a 25% share, building physics engineers are in high demand for their expertise in energy-efficient designs. 2. Sustainability Consultant: Professionals in this role advise clients on implementing sustainable practices and technologies in their projects, making up 20% of the market. 3. Energy Engineer: Energy engineers are responsible for designing and implementing energy-efficient systems in buildings. They account for 15% of the industry. 4. BIM Manager: A BIM manager oversees the implementation and management of Building Information Modeling (BIM) processes in architectural and engineering projects. This role represents 10% of the market. 5. LEED/BREEAM Assessor: LEED and BREEAM assessors evaluate building projects for certification, ensuring they meet specific environmental and sustainability standards, accounting for 10% of the market. 6. Commissioning Authority: These professionals ensure building systems are installed, tested, and operating correctly, representing 10% of the market. 7. Indoor Air Quality Specialist: This role focuses on optimizing indoor environments for occupant health and well-being, with a 10% share in the industry.
